Abstract

The process of globalization has undoubtedly led to the transformation of nations into multicultural and multi-religious societies, fostering contacts between peoples with different cultural and religious traditions and increasing possibilities for mutual understanding. Therefore, after outlining the socio-historical framework of the Islamic presence in Italy, this chapter shall explore the halal issue in Italy in terms of market, policies, services and certification process. Ultimately, the goal is to take a snapshot of the current state of halal in Italy, considering it one of the elements that qualify pluralistic societies, respectful of affiliations and differences, even beyond mere economic logic. However, the growth in demand for halal products in Italy does not seem to be accompanied by an adequate supply. Therefore, a paradigm shift is needed where the quality of “Made in Italy” meets the needs of a growing community.
